This semester, the Riverside High School Choir will be participating in State Solo/Ensemble contest which takes place on Saturday, April 14th 2012. Solo/Ensemble Contest is an opportunity for all students to develop and hone their skills as musicians and receive feedback from a state approved judge. Students will prepare vocal solo’s and/or work in a small group to sing 3-8 part accompanied/acapella music.
